A Glimpse into History: The 1505 and its Significance

The reference 1505, a 35mm Oyster Perpetual Date from the 1970s, embodies a specific era in Rolex's history. This period saw a shift in design language, with subtle changes reflecting the evolving tastes of the time. The combination of 14k gold and stainless steel (often referred to as "two-tone") was a popular choice, offering a blend of luxury and practicality. The automatic movement within, likely a calibre 1570 or a variant, provided reliable timekeeping, a hallmark of Rolex craftsmanship. Examining a specific example like the 1505 allows us to appreciate the evolution of the model and understand the nuances that distinguish vintage pieces from their modern counterparts. The 1970s were a period of experimentation for Rolex, and the 1505 reflects this, offering a fascinating glimpse into the brand's history and its commitment to innovation. Finding a well-preserved example of a 1505 today is a testament to Rolex's enduring build quality and the desirability of vintage timepieces.

The Allure of the 35mm Case:

While modern trends often favor larger watches, the 35mm Oyster Perpetual Date maintains a dedicated following. This size offers a balance between presence on the wrist and comfortable wearability. It's neither overwhelmingly large nor excessively small, making it suitable for a wide range of wrist sizes and styles. The 35mm case perfectly complements the classic design, ensuring that the watch remains elegant and understated without sacrificing its impact. This size also appeals to those who appreciate a more vintage-inspired aesthetic, as it echoes the proportions of earlier Rolex models. The subtle elegance of the 35mm case makes it a versatile piece that can be dressed up or down, seamlessly transitioning from a formal event to a casual outing.

Rolex Oyster Perpetual Size Chart: Finding the Perfect Fit

Understanding the various sizes within the Rolex Oyster Perpetual line is crucial for finding the perfect fit. A Rolex Oyster Perpetual size chart typically includes details on case diameter, lug-to-lug measurement (the distance between the lugs where the straps attach), and thickness. This information allows prospective buyers to compare different models and determine which size best suits their wrist. While the 35mm is a popular size, Rolex also offers the Oyster Perpetual in 34mm, 36mm, and 41mm, catering to a broader range of preferences. The 34mm, for instance, is often considered a more feminine size, while the 41mm appeals to those who prefer a bolder statement. Consulting a detailed size chart is essential before making a purchase to ensure a comfortable and aesthetically pleasing fit.
